What you’ll do

We are seeking an innovative LLM Engineer Lead / NLP Engineer Lead to join our Big Data

and AI Team. In this role, you will be at the forefront of implementing state-of-the-art Large

Language Models (LLMs) for a range of applications, from understanding to generation tasks

Your work will directly contribute to integrating advanced AI capabilities into our

products and services, enhancing user experience, and driving business value.

• Design and implement Large Language Models for a variety of NLP tasks such as text classification, entity recognition, and question answering

• Integrate LLMs into existing and new products, ensuring they enhance functionality and user experience

• Manage and optimize the infrastructure required for the data-intensive processes of training, fine-tuning, and deploying LLMs

• Monitor and assess LLM performance in production environments, identifying and resolving issues to maintain high standards of reliability and efficiency

• Work closely with data engineers to ensure a smooth data pipeline for model training and inference

• Collaborate with product teams to understand requirements and deliver AI features that align with business goals

• Stay abreast of the latest developments in NLP and machine learning, and incorporate cutting-edge research and techniques into our systems

• Document the development process, architecture, and standard operating procedures for knowledge sharing and future reference

• Presenting the results to technical and non- technical audiences

Who you are

•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Artificial Intelligence, Computational Linguistics, or a related field. PHD degree will be a plus.

• 6+ years experience in developing, implementing and maintaining NLP products

• Proficiency in designing, training, and fine-tuning machine learning models, particularly in the context of NLP, using frameworks such as TensorFlow and PyTorch.

• Expertise in working with state-of-the-art deep learning architectures for NLP,such as Transformer models(BERT,GPT), recurrent neural networks (RNNs), and convolutional neural networks

• Proficiency with LLM frameworks such as Transformers from Hugging Face.

• Strong understanding of Word embeddings, contextual embeddings (e.g. Word2Vec, GloVe, ELMo), and pre-trained language models (e.g., BERT, RoBERTa)

• Solid experience with NLP tasks including but not limited to text classification, entity recognition, sentiment analysis, and question answering

• Strong software engineering background, with proficiency in programming languages like Python

• Experience with deploying scalable AI systems in production environments

• Excellent communication skills, with the ability to present technical results to non-technical audiences

• Ability to guide junior nlp engineers in their skill sets, motivate them, and build the company’s foundation for future growth
